A number of funds may be available to aid cover the expenses of take care of the person with Alzheimer's or various other mental deterioration. Some might use currently and others in the future. Find out exactly how to place legal and monetary plans in position, and how to accessibility resources near you. For many people 65 or older, Medicare is the main resource of healthcare protection.
The person with dementia additionally might have the ability to take out money from his or her IRA or employee-funded retired life strategy prior to age 59 1/2 without paying the normal 10 percent very early withdrawal charge. This cash usually will be taken into consideration regular income, and tax obligations will certainly need to be paid on the quantity withdrawn.
The amount the person is qualified to obtain is normally based on the person's age, home's equity and loan provider's rate of interest. Reverse home loans do not have an influence on Social Safety or Medicare advantages, but they may affect the person's capability to get various other federal government programs. Veterans Management (VA) solutions for professionals living with Alzheimer's or dementia and their caretakers can include in-home care, lasting domestic treatment, hospice and reprieve for caretakers.

Alzheimer's and dementia caregivers prepare to aid your senior enjoyed ones Around 5. 5 million Americans over the age of 65 are impacted by Alzheimer's illness and other types of dementia. Mental deterioration is an umbrella term that explains degenerative cognitive conditions, such as Alzheimer's, that affect memory and cognitive capability with time.
Quickly those impacted will certainly neglect acquainted faces and ultimately lose the ability for basic self-care. Those with Alzheimer's and various other kinds of mental deterioration need constant treatment to live securely, and it is best for them to receive treatment in the house in an acquainted atmosphere. Our caregivers have received additional training to properly care for those in any stage of Alzheimer's and various other kinds of mental deterioration in their homes.
Those impacted by these conditions experience problems in believing that can adversely affect their lives and communication with others. It is essential to recognize that the term "dementia" does not describe a certain disease. It refers even more to the signs and symptoms that happen in illness such as Alzheimer's in which those influenced shed their memory and experiential expertise.
